Redhawks Drop Conference Match Against Alfred State

ALFRED, N.Y. – La Roche men's soccer was unable to come through with a second straight victory, as they were defeated by Alfred State 11-1 on Saturday.

 

Alfred State started the scoring just 2:35 into the match and would eventually head into halftime with a 6-0 lead.

 

At 54:04, the Pioneers made it 7-0, but the Redhawks would respond with their lone goal just 4:13 later when Tyler Bryan scored on an assist from Samuel Mastroberardino.

 

Alfred State closed the match with four more goals between the 59:26 mark and 86:01 point of the game.

 

The shot total was highly in favor of the Pioneers, 34-4 and shots on goal also favored Alfred State 19-2.

 

Between the pipes, sophomore goalkeeper Kyle Rizzo halted four of the 10 shots he faced, playing the first half, while fellow sophomore Logan McQueen made four saves of his own, facing nine shots.

 

Four different Redhawks had a shot in the game, including Bryan and senior Jake Gorman who combined for the two shots on goal.

 

La Roche concludes its road portion of the 2023 schedule when they travel to Pitt-Greensburg on Wednesday, Oct. 18 for a 3 p.m. kickoff.
